What is the cost for a Verizon senior plan?

Verizon's 55+ Unlimited Plan starts at $60 per month for one line, or $80 per month for two lines (plus applicable taxes and fees). This is an average savings of $5 to $15 per line compared to their standard unlimited plans, which range from $65 to $75 per line for the same features.

What is the cheapest plan for Verizon?

Verizon's cheapest plan is the Verizon Basic Phone 500 MB plan. It costs $30 per month, postpaid. It has just 500 MB of data per month, making it an option for users who use very little data. It also comes with unlimited talking and text time.

Is Verizon senior plan only in Florida?

Following T-Mobile's lead on the topic, Verizon in February launched a plan for customers in Florida who are 55 years old and over that provides a single line of unlimited service for $60 per month or two lines for $80 per month. Now, the carrier is expanding that offering to two more states, Illinois or Missouri.
